I'm a professional photographer, and I've used a number of tripods but this is the best I've ever used for several reasons: 1) It's heavy duty enough to handle over 10 lbs (4 kg) with the right tripod head (I recommend the 3047) yet it's still relatively lightweight. 2) The legs are independently adjustable, unlike the type that connect the legs to the center post. You can spread out the legs almost flat. Or each leg can be a different angle, useful for stairs or uneven ground. 3) The center post is in two parts, and you can remove the bottom half, allowing you to have the camera 6 inches off the ground. I use this a lot when photographing babies on the ground. 5) If you need to get your camera even closer to the ground, you can reverse the center column and mount your camera upside down.Read full review

I purchased this tripod for it's parts. Some of the parts on my original Bogen 3021 that I purchased new in 1987 wore out after 30 years of hard use. I have considered replacing it many times over the years with something lighter or smaller. But I always realize I would have to compromise somewhere with the new purchase. Either with significant cost or severe loss of stability. So I was both too cheap and was unwilling to buy anything less stable. This tripod is an absolute bargain for what it cost used. It's not a light tripod, nor is it small. It's is however small and light enough for most things, yet sturdy enough for just about any modern camera and lens combo. I have a small light tripod that I never use, a Bogen 3021 and a massive Bogen 3058. The 3021 is my go too for the majority of my tripod use.Read full review
